The National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S) is a new way of providing supports for people with disability, their family and carers.
The NDIS is being trialled in several areas across Australia, including the ACT. The ACT will be the first jurisdiction in Australia to have all eligible residents included in the Scheme by July 2016. Because this is a big change, rollout in the ACT is staged. High school students were scheduled to transition to the NDIS between January and March 2015, followed by primary school students between April and September 2015. Please note students may still apply to participate in the Scheme after their scheduled phasing period.
